 What the hell is Brian?
Brian is a digital teaching assistant for schools and universities. The software allows teachers to instantly create an appealing, adaptive learning tool for the specific content of their courses. Content creation is powered by AI and takes only a few minutes per course unit.
The learning itself takes place on the smartphone or tablet, where learners are immersed in a personalized learning world that connects them socially and makes them active participants in the learning process. Brian creates more motivated, better-informed students. Analytics provide insight into learners' learning paths and knowledge levels, which helps teachers teach better.
Didactically, Brian is primarily used as an asynchronous learning and homework tool. It motivates students, adapts to their level of knowledge and supports them 24/7, without their needing access to teachers or tutors.
